Paramount Global is engaged in discussions with the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) regarding the approval process for its proposed merger with Skydance Media. The talks include considerations of potential concessions related to corporate diversity initiatives, which Paramount may need to adjust or abstain from to secure the FCC's approval. These initial discussions mark a critical step in the regulatory review of the merger, highlighting the FCC's focus on diversity policies as part of its evaluation criteria.
